On most digital cameras:

TV mode:
adjust Shutter Speed (1/4, 3")

AV mode:
aperture priority
"wide open" fastest
smaller number, the
letting more/less light in
F16 less light,  F2 more light in

Smaller Aperture, higher depth of field


Looking to capture Stop action?
TV mode preferred so you can control for a quick shutter speed.
